Abstract/Summary:
One of the most important supporting tools to protect biological diversity is the identification of the controlling factors of its spatial patterns. The author has evaluated the controlling factors of the spatial patterns of landscape and species diversity. Also, habitat models of two endangered species of birds have been developed: Dupont Larks, Chersophilus duponti , and White-backed Woodpecker, Dendrocopos leucotos. Spatial databases of species distribution, maps of environmental variables (climate, lithology, land-covers) and historical factors were related using Generalised Additive Models as non-parametric regression tool and GIS. The spatial pattern of biological diversity, as the main conclusion, is the result of different processes belonging to different spatial and temporal scales. Also, as conclusions focused on biodiversity management, high levels of landscape diversity and low levels of habitat fragmentation must be encouraged in order to maintain high levels of species diversity.
